The 2N4922G is an NPN silicon transistor from On Semiconductor designed for medium-power applications. It features a collector-emitter voltage (VCEO) of 60V and a continuous collector current rating of 1A, with a peak current capability of 3A. The device can dissipate up to 30W at a case temperature of 25°C, with a derating factor of 0.24 W/°C above 25°C.
This transistor offers a DC current gain (hFE) of at least 30 at 500mA and 1V, and a low saturation voltage of 600mV at 1A collector current. It is housed in a TO-225AA / TO-126-3 through-hole package, making it suitable for PCB mounting. The operating junction temperature range is -65°C to 150°C.
The 2N4922G is Pb-Free and RoHS3 compliant. It is intended for use in driver circuits, switching applications, and general-purpose amplifier designs. The PNP complement is the 2N4920G.
